    Resolved Opening word documents [resolved]

    I've written an app that automates word and it works quite happily on my dev. machine. Of course, I go to install it on the test server and it falls on it's backside because it fails when I try to add a document to the App.Documents collection using the Open method.

    I have done a variety of File.Exists scenarios to make sure the file is there and it still fails.

    What am I doing wrong?

    Note to self. When you ask the system admin to install Word 2003, don't believe he will do as you ask...always double check yourself....
    It couldn't handle the XP dlls with the 2k3 interops.
